#746556 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#746556 is composed of 45.5% red, 39.6% green and 33.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 12.9% magenta, 25.9% yellow and 54.5% black. It has a hue angle of 30 degrees, a saturation of 14.9% and a lightness of 39.6%. #746556 color hex could be obtained by blending #e8caac with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

#746556 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#746556 has RGB values of R:116, G:101, B:86 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.13, Y:0.26, K:0.55. Its decimal value is 7628118.
